Welcome to the official site for the 2007 USRC National
Sieger Show. The show will be held in Kimberton, PA in
Chester County. Chester County is approximately 762
square miles and is located in the heart of Southeastern
Pennsylvania. The county was one of the three original
counties in Pennsylvania and was created by William
Penn in 1682; there are now 67 counties in PA.

The show site is Kimberton Fairgrounds, a 22 acre facility
located on the
Kimberton Fire Company grounds and is
host to the annual
Kimberton Fair, held the last July of
every year for the last 76 years, and which draws people
from all over the Mid-Atlantic region. The Fair has seen
many changes over the years: a 10-day fair to a 6-day
fair; entertaining trapeze artists to racing pigs to
automobile raffles to cash prizes But the heart of the Fair
has stayed the same: a wholesome place run by
volunteers where folks can come to see each other, enjoy
homemade food, and have fun with their friends and
family.
The show, themed Rotts-n-Vettes-n-Rods will be a three-day affair
officiated by ADRK Körmeister Jürgen Wulff and Hetje Lashley-Harmsma,
FCI Netherlands. Puppy classes will commence of Friday, followed by
youth classes on Saturday and adult classes on Sunday. Also on
Sunday, in conjunction with the Sieger show, SPARK will be hosting a
Corvette and Street Rod Show. This is likely to draw in many observers
who are new to the Rottweiler breed and will allow them to see a different
aspect of the breed.

In addition to conformation, there will be health clinics, games, demos,
breed tests, working events and a protection tournament.

SPARK is also very pleased to announce that we will be hosting a
breeding seminar with Oliver Neubrand from the very famous Hause
Neubrand kennels in Germany.
